South Bay Survivorship Consortium
Torrance Memorial Medical Center, HealthCare Partners Medical Group, Cancer Care Associates and the California Hematology Oncology Medical Group have joined together in partnership and formed the South Bay Survivorship Consortium to bring a wider array of support resources to those diagnosed with cancer, undergoing treatment or in remission.
The group will present “Exploring Dimensions of Your Survivorship: A Workshop for Cancer Survivors and Loved Ones,” from 6 to 8 p.m., Tuesday, August 17 in the West Tower Auditorium, 2nd Floor.
Admission is FREE.
Seating is limited and reservations can be made by calling 310-517-4660.

Healthy Ever After - A nutrition program for children and families!
These fun, interactive classes on nutrition and fitness will be taught by registered dietitians and guest instructors including a psychologist and exercise physiologist. The program promotes healthy lifestyle choices by providing useful information and practical tips through hands-on learning, fun exercises, parent and child activities and more.
For children aged 9 to 12 and their families; open to all, not just for those seeking weight management. Each child must be accompanied by a parent or guardian. One Tuesday per month, from 6pm - 8pm. June 8, July 13, August 10, September 14, October 12, November 9, December 14. Families do not have to start at any particular time, or finish all 12 months.
